Hotels-Apartment in Schiller Park, IL

4 businesses found


Twelve Oaks Suites

9450 Lawrence Avenue , 60176
Phone: (847) 725-2210

Shree Vinayak Inc

10249 Irving Park Road , 60176
Phone: (847) 671-6000

Four Points

10249 Irving Park Road , 60176
Phone: (847) 671-6000